What companies run services between Germany and Pinneberg, Schleswig-Holstein, Germany?

Deutsche Bahn Intercity (DB IC) operates a train from Berlin Hbf to Hamburg Dammtor hourly. Tickets cost €50–130 and the journey takes 1h 54m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Berlin Alexanderplatz to Hamburg, Zentraler Omnibusbahnhof 3 times a day. Tickets cost €20–35 and the journey takes 3h 30m.
